Output 694db7db3f9fa1246f40a28440fbdc2a269f9d558083ea52efb80b7ca5633906:3

value
83050697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8218abef9d2149fd71b4c8aff6156e8d0613bf7d OP_EQUAL
address
3DYuKhLUy1sus6EHXrVhLNWHk2uZbWcyZ4
transaction
694db7db3f9fa1246f40a28440fbdc2a269f9d558083ea52efb80b7ca5633906
spent
true